UNOH Crowned as Men's Tennis Tournament Champion

UNOH Crowned as Men's Tennis Tournament Champion

LIMA, Ohio - (TOURNAMENT PAGE) - UNOH made it a clean sweep, winning both the Wolverine-Hoosier Athletic Conference (WHAC) Men's Tennis regular season championship and tournament championship. The top-seeded Racers defeated No. 3 Cornerstone 4-0 at Westwood Tennis & Fitness Center. UNOH has now won the last eight tournament titles of the 10 tournaments been held since the sport was reistated as a conference sport in 2011. 

As the top seed, the Racers enjoyed a bye in the first round and blanked Lawrence Tech in the semifinals. Cornerstone defeated No. 6 Lourdes in the first round and upset second-seeded Indiana Tech 4-2 in the semis.

In the championship match, UNOH took the double point, winning both the No. 1 and No. 2 matches. WHAC Player of the Year Sergio Conde won his No. 1 singles match while Malik Omarkhanov and Nils Messin won at the No. 4 and No. 5 spots, respectively.  

With the win, UNOH receives the WHAC's automatic berth to the NAIA Men's Tennis National Championship May 16-20 in Mobile, Ala.
